General Information

Title: Harke, harke wot yee wat
Composer: Robert Jones

Number of voices: 3vv   Voicing: SAB

Genre: Secular, Lute song

Language: English
Instruments: three part singing with Lute
Published: 1609

Description: Lute song from A Musicall Dreame or the fourt booke of Ayres
